ITAC serves Process & Industrial clients with integrated engineering and construction services for complex capital projects. We also offer specialty services including power systems services and products, custom machine fabrication, and fall protection services and equipment. Founded in 1988 on a dream and a $5K loan, ITAC is a true success story. From humble beginnings to an ENR-Ranked Top Design Firm with a nationwide footprint and over 500 employees operating from 6 offices in Virginia, North Carolina and South Carolina, we provide Fortune 500 companies with innovative design-build solutions. We specialize in power generation & utilities, chemicals, food & beverage, forest products, advanced manufacturing, and minerals & metals.

ITAC’s purpose is to make life better. For our employees, this means providing them with the resources and flexibility they need to have both a rewarding career and a fulfilling family life. ITAC is 100% employee-owned. Through our Employee Stock Ownership Plan (ESOP) and Direct Stock Ownership, every team member has the unique opportunity to be an owner who shares in the company’s growth and earnings. This is a seconded position, meaning the selected candidate will be employed by ITAC but work full-time on assignment with one of our clients. While day-to-day responsibilities will be managed on-site with the client, ITAC provides ongoing support, resources, and benefits as your employer. This position is full time contract work anticipated to last through the end of 2026, and requires the employee to be on the client's Hopewell, VA site. Overview

As a Project Engineer, you will have the opportunity to collaborate with cross-functional teams and support projects from planning through completion. You will play a key role in coordinating technical and construction activities, ensuring projects are delivered on time, within budget, and in accordance with quality standards. This position requires strong technical, organizational, problem-solving, and communication skills, as well as a solid understanding of engineering principles, construction processes, and industry best practices.

Responsibilities

  • Support the execution of multiple projects simultaneously, ensuring all project phases are completed within established scope, budget, and schedule requirements.
  • Collaborate with clients, project managers, and internal teams to understand project requirements and develop effective engineering and construction solutions.
  • Assist in the preparation of project proposals, cost estimates, schedules, and technical documentation for client review and approval.
  • Coordinate with subcontractors, vendors, and project stakeholders to ensure project objectives and deliverables are achieved.
  • Monitor project budgets, schedules, and performance metrics, identifying potential risks and supporting the implementation of corrective actions.
  • Facilitate communication and collaboration among project team members, clients, contractors, and other stakeholders.
  • Conduct site visits and inspections to monitor project progress, verify quality standards, and ensure compliance with safety requirements and applicable regulations.
  • Prepare and maintain accurate project documentation, reports, meeting minutes, and progress updates for clients, management, and project stakeholders.
  • Assist with construction administration activities, including reviewing submittals, RFIs, change orders, and project closeout documentation.

Requirements

  • Bachelor's degree in Engineering or a related field
  • Proven engineering and project management experience in the construction industry, preferably in the Process & Industrial sector
  • Strong knowledge of construction processes, codes, and regulations
  • Exceptional leadership and decision-making skills with the ability to solve complex problems
  • Excellent communication and interpersonal skills with the ability to effectively collaborate with multidisciplinary teams
  • Proficient in project management software and tools
  • Ability to prioritize tasks, manage multiple projects, and work under time constraints
  • Demonstrated ability to manage project budgets, costs, and profitability
  • Valid driver's license and willingness to travel to project sites as required
